Cisco Nexus EIGRP Neighbor Route Preference Not Possible on the same Interface? by travispk in networking

[–]travispk[S] 5 points6 points  (0 children)

WOW! After a lot of trial and error, I found something that worked! Since the routes I wanted to match are coming from other routers redistributing BGP, I was able to get matching on tags to work! Oddly, I could only get it to raise the metric on the routes being learned, I could not get it to go lower, especially enough to win, so I switched to poisoning unpreferred neighbors / routes instead of making them better. The outcome is what I want!

route-map POSION_NEIGHBOR permit 10
match tag 6939
set metric 10000 300 255 1 1500
route-map POSION_NEIGHBOR permit 20

int vlan 402
ip distribute-list eigrp 1 route-map POSION_NEIGHBOR in

sh ip eigrp 1 topology all-links
